Output c3f8db65a16f6e4e5631af7f25970a95eefc380cc3f143ee026add8ee4c14bba:1

value
42479
script pubkey
OP_0 OP_PUSHBYTES_20 ef20bbf6ef259e42824d10cce02bb8cc33f1ffb6
address
bc1qausthah0yk0y9qjdzrxwq2aceselrlak08t2hj
transaction
c3f8db65a16f6e4e5631af7f25970a95eefc380cc3f143ee026add8ee4c14bba
spent
true